As for the idea of schools...I have no problem making calls on anything, glad to help, however, I am in the Sierras and not the bay area. Also, your idea on schools is tricky...here's why
1. Elementary schools and middle schools change according to population demographics..meaning that even though a school is there now it may or may not have been in the 70s. (Look at classmates.com, and pick a city, numerous schools to look at, some are newer, some are older, some have one school added into another, this is difficult to track info)
2. High schools are better to research because they tend to be larger and stay put, though they integrate old schools into new, and close less often than the smaller ones. Some schools have no one on reunion sites, they were small and people dont search reunion.
3. The yearbook idea..no one 'loans' out the one copy on record, of said school. You must go to the school and view it, in their office. What if you find 25 girls that look like a possible Anna, in black and white photos, at 18 different schools, can you call them all? or even find them, with a current married name?
The idea of school records, without having a definite city, to me, seems like a needle in a haystack, that is unlikely to produce results that would be worthwhile.
If you have the 1970s phone records (if it has all schools listed, and you have an absolute city of origin) you might be able to narrow your search.

I use schools to trace, only if I have a name, and know where someone grew up...and even then its tough to get the old info, much of this is archved and many schools don't have old records of schools integrated into them, it might bring up a few leads...if narrowed down.
